Erin and I refuse to pay for cable television or a satellite dish. We had purchased a set of rabbit ears, that was touted as being perfect for the new digital signals. Reception was spotty at best. Next, we experimented with an antenna called the Leaf. You hang it on the wall like a painting. It doesn't work either. Last weekend, Winston and I installed an old fashioned arial antenna in our attic. See photo. We then ran a co-axial cable down from the attic and into the basement and then over and up to the TV. Every single channel that the TV detects, we now receive crystal clear and for FREE! Tengo gusto realmente de una visiĆ³n.
